How Web Design Works: A Comprehensive Guide
Web design is a crucial aspect of any business’s online presence. It’s what makes a website visually appealing and easy to navigate, ultimately leading to increased user engagement and conversions. In this comprehensive guide, we’ll delve into the world of web design, exploring its various elements, techniques, and best practices.
Understanding the Basics of Web Design
Web design involves creating a website’s visual structure, including layout, color scheme, typography, images, and multimedia content. It also encompasses user experience (UX) design, which focuses on making websites intuitive, accessible, and enjoyable to use.
Effective web design requires a combination of creative and technical skills, including graphic design, coding, and problem-solving abilities. Web designers must be familiar with various design tools, such as Adobe Creative Suite, Sketch, and Figma, as well as coding languages like HTML, CSS, and JavaScript.
A Good Website Design Starts with Planning
Before diving into the design process, it’s essential to have a clear understanding of your website’s goals and target audience. This involves conducting market research, analyzing competitors, and identifying user needs and preferences.
Once you have a solid plan in place, you can start designing your website’s layout, choosing colors, typography, images, and other design elements that align with your brand identity and resonate with your target audience.
Designing for User Experience
User experience (UX) is a critical aspect of web design, as it determines how users interact with and perceive your website. Effective UX design involves creating an intuitive, accessible, and enjoyable user interface that guides visitors towards their desired actions, whether it’s making a purchase or filling out a form.
Some key elements of UX design include:
- Navigation: A clear and organized navigation menu makes it easy for users to find what they’re looking for.
- Responsive design: A responsive website adapts to different screen sizes, ensuring a seamless user experience across devices.
- Loading speed: Fast loading times are essential for keeping users engaged and preventing bounce rates.
- Accessibility: Ensuring your website is accessible to all users, including those with disabilities, is crucial for building an inclusive online presence.
Designing for Mobile Users
With the rise of mobile devices, it’s more important than ever to design websites that are optimized for mobile use. This involves creating a responsive layout that adapts to smaller screen sizes and touch-based interactions.
Some key considerations for mobile web design include:
- Simplifying navigation: Mobile users often have shorter attention spans, so it’s essential to keep your website’s navigation simple and straightforward.
- Using clear typography: Large, easy-to-read fonts are crucial for mobile users who may be viewing your website on a small screen.
- Minimizing images and multimedia content: While images and videos can add visual appeal to a website, they can also slow down loading times on mobile devices. Use them sparingly and optimize them for fast loading.
Best Practices for Web Design
Here are some best practices for web design that will help ensure your website is both visually appealing and easy to use:
- Keep it simple: Avoid cluttering your website with too many design elements or excessive text. Keep the focus on your brand identity and user needs.
- Use white space effectively: White space, or negative space, can help create a sense of balance and harmony in your website’s design. Use it to break up blocks of text and draw attention to important elements.
- Choose colors wisely: Colors can evoke emotions and convey meaning, so choose them carefully based on your brand identity and target audience. Stick to a limited color palette to keep your website visually cohesive.
- Use typography to create hierarchy: Typography can help guide users’ attention and create a visual hierarchy on your website. Use larger font sizes for headings and subheadings, and smaller fonts for body text.
- Optimize images for fast loading: Images are an essential part of web design, but they can also slow down loading times. Optimize them for fast loading without sacrificing quality.